You clearly don't understand how things work in today's world. Plane tickets, hotel room rates, and rental car rates all change constantly based on demand and other factors. The is especially true of plane tickets and car rentals. If you find a rate you like, reserve it. Period.
I don't know about Australia, but in the US, you don't even need to pay to reserve a car, and there is no penalty for canceling.
